Output 46860a22f449824d2851169bec20d496f2c71243f557449b44e19e1989e88817:3

value
100659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db08e2390b1fc81ca70b0fe2553d59452051156c OP_EQUAL
address
3MfAYoZzBY6rhJ9GiDp7SAZGvmh3nEe9Zp
transaction
46860a22f449824d2851169bec20d496f2c71243f557449b44e19e1989e88817
confirmations
249162
spent
true